While riding on the bus, I found this religious tract, and I liked it so much, I’ve reprinted it in part below. Note: Unlike almost everything else I publish here, I did not write this. It’s credited to someone named D.W. Matter. Just so you don’t think I write this badly, or, depending on what you think of this piece, this well.

See if you can find my favorite unintentional joke. Hint: it starts with a C.

“I Want to Go to Hell”

By D. W. Matter

“I want to go to hell!” stated a ten-year-old boy, “Because I want to be with my Dad; and so that I can go and get his cigarettes for him.” What an influence that father is having over his son! What a highway of influence that father is paving for his boy to travel!

There are thousands of parents spending their time drinking and dancing in taverns and coming home cursing, smoking and fighting. What an influence for a child! What conduct for any father or mother!

Why wonder at all the juvenile deliquency, when our teen-age boys and girls are following their parents’ example of crowding the beer taverns and flooding our streets with wrecked characters? Our prisons are filling with criminals and prostitutes from fourteen to twenty years of age.

Father! Mother! Are you setting the example that is leading our American youth down to the gutters of shame and debauchery? We have wholesale divorce, wrecked homes, and orphans all because of a generation of lust-craving, immoral, drunken, pleasure-mad parents who care nothing for the future of their children.

The harvest is great, and America shall reap what she is sowing: drunkards, criminals, unwed mothers, wrecked youths, infidelity, and communism.

If someone should step up to your child today and ask him to attend Sunday school next Sunday, would he answer, “No, I want to go to hell so I can be with my daddy or mother”? Friend, is that the kind of influence that your life is having upon your children? If it is, Jesus would like to change it for you if you will let Him.

Will you come to Him confessing your sins with a sorrow that will make you quit your wickedness and live for God? America’s only hope is in God and an old-fashioned turning to God. Will you, my friend, be one of the first?

If we confess our sins, he [Jesus] is faithful and just to forgive our sins, and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ness (I John 1:9).

“But except ye repent ye shall all likewise perish” (Luke 13:3).
